Homecoming Week!

It's already homecoming week here at LHU so that is super exciting and there are a lot of fun activities taking place. Wednesday there will be a hypnotist which is always so funny to watch. A group of Lock Haven students will go onto stage and entertain us all. Then, Thursday an illusionist is coming. I really enjoy seeing all of these types of things so it will be a really fun event my friends and I will attend. Finally, Saturday will be our homecoming football game. I am very excited to go to the game and cheer on the team. At halftime, the king and queen will be crowned. I can't wait to see who will win. I know a lot of the nominees and it will be a hard decision of who I will vote for. A lot of alumni come to LHU for homecoming to catch up with old friends and see some people and professors they may not have seen for a while. I am excited to talk to some of the people that have graduated and see what they have been up to and how their jobs are coming along.
I also quite a busy week with school work, tests, and club meetings. I have both a real analysis and educational psychology test this Thursday so I am studying for those and then math club this week. In math club this week, we will be finalizing some different things we have been talking about such as an upcoming conference in November, making t-shirts for the club, and an end of the semester celebration for those graduating in December. The conference will be held in Lake Harmony, PA and is geared towards mathematics teachers. I am sure I will learn a lot from the different workshops I will attend. I enjoy going to conferences because they get you prepared for being in schools and things to look forward to. I will be sure to let you know how it goes. Until then, Have a great week!

Fall Holiday

Yesterday was fall holiday which occurs each October. We had the day off of school and a long weekend which was nice to be able to catch up on some work and this next weekend is admissions open house, our second of the year.
Saturday is also family day which is a lot of fun. Family members come and visit you. The resident halls have refreshments and its a great time for mom and dad to meet the friends you have made here at Lock Haven. This year they are also doing family photos, black and white shots. I think the most exciting part of the day is the casino they have in the Parson's Union Building. They have all kinds of card games, and roulette tables, etc. to play with fake chips. With the more chips you have you can buy tickets and then are eligible for some awesome prizes. They are also showing 2 big screen movies, Wall-e and Get Smart. It will definitely be a day full of fun with the family!
